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) – Banned From Online Casino

1. What does it mean to be “banned from an online casino”?

Being banned from an online casino means that you have been prohibited from accessing or playing on a specific online casino website. This can happen for various reasons, such as violating the casino's terms and conditions, fraudulent activity, or self-exclusion.

2. How do I know if I am banned from an online casino?

You will typically receive a notification from the casino stating that your account has been banned. You may also notice that you are unable to access the casino's website or login to your account. In some cases, you may also receive an email explaining the reason for the ban.

3. Can I get unbanned from an online casino?

It depends on the reason for your ban. If it was due to violating the casino's terms and conditions, you can reach out to their customer support and try to resolve the issue. However, if it was due to fraudulent activity or self-exclusion, it is unlikely that you will be able to get unbanned.

4. How long does a ban from an online casino last?

The duration of a ban can vary depending on the casino's policies and the reason for the ban. Some bans may be temporary and can last anywhere from a few days to several months, while others may be permanent.

5. Can I still withdraw my funds if I am banned from an online casino?

If your account has been banned, you may still be able to withdraw your funds. However, this will also depend on the casino's policies and the reason for the ban. If you have any difficulties withdrawing your funds, it is best to contact the casino's customer support for assistance.

6. Can I use VPN to bypass a ban from an online casino?

Using a virtual private network (VPN) to bypass a ban from an online casino is not recommended and may result in further consequences. Most casinos have strict policies against players using VPNs to access their website, and doing so may lead to account suspension or permanent ban.

7. Are there any legal implications for being banned from an online casino?

Being banned from an online casino does not necessarily have any legal implications. However, if the reason for the ban is due to fraudulent activity or violating the casino's terms and conditions, there may be legal consequences. It is always best to adhere to a casino's rules and regulations to avoid any potential legal issues.

8. Can I open a new account if I am banned from an online casino?

In most cases, if you have been banned from an online casino, you will not be able to open a new account. Casinos have strict policies to prevent players from creating multiple accounts, and attempting to do so may result in a permanent ban.

9. What can I do to prevent being banned from an online casino?

To avoid being banned from an online casino, it is essential to read and follow their terms and conditions carefully. Make sure to only use your own account and avoid any fraudulent activity. If you have any concerns or questions, it is best to contact the casino's customer support for clarification.

10. Is it possible to be banned from all online casinos?

Yes, it is possible to be banned from all online casinos. Many casinos are connected through a shared database that tracks player's activity and bans. This is why it is crucial to always follow the rules and regulations of online casinos to avoid getting banned from not just one, but multiple casinos.
